St. Louis Rams Should Just Say No To T.O.
The Rams need as much talent as they can get.
But they don't need Terrell Owens.
Nevermind that Owens is one of the most disruptive, egomaniacal, self-aggrandizing players in the history of the league.

Nevermind that he's burned bridges with virtually every team he's played for.
Nevermind that he's been among the league leaders in dropped passes in the last few years.
The biggest reason to avoid him is that whatever short-term benefit he'd provide would be outweighed by the negative impact he'd have on the Rams' young WR corps.
Owens is not the mentor type. No matter what he might say now, his primary interest is to get the ball as much as possible so he can pad his career numbers.
That's not what Donnie Avery, Laurent Robinson, Mardy Gilyard and Brandon Gibson need. They need to face the trial by fire and develop on the field.
More importantly, Sam Bradford needs to develop a rhythm with the young guys. The payoff will be greater if he "grows up" with the same receivers. Owens would only interrupt that progression by demanding that he be the "No. 1 guy."
The impatience of many Rams fans is understandable. Its been a rough few years, and a "big name" like Owens would provide instant gratification for some.
But, in the end, its more important to build a solid foundation for the future.
Owens does not fit in this plan.
Just say "no" to T.O.
